About Kenworth Heavy Haul Trucks
Powertrain matters more in heavy haul than in standard over-the-road service. Many buyers look for big-bore diesel platforms such as the Cummins X15 or ISX family paired with automated manual or manual transmissions that offer deep reduction gearing. For true heavy spec work, transmission model, rear axle ratio, and suspension rating are as important as horsepower. A truck that looks similar from the outside can perform very differently depending on whether it has 3.36 rears for faster highway running or a much deeper ratio intended for lowboy, multi-axle, or permit loads. Double-frame construction, heavier front axle ratings, locking differentials, and driveline protection are all worth confirming when the truck will spend time starting heavy loads on uneven ground or climbing in low gear.
Kenworth models seen in heavy haul applications can range from aerodynamic highway tractors adapted for lighter specialized service to purpose-built vocational platforms such as the W900, T800, or C500 family. The right choice depends on the work. A more highway-oriented tractor may fit regional machinery moves, construction support, or moderate oversize freight where fuel economy and driver comfort still matter. A dedicated heavy spec truck is better suited for lowboy work, oilfield support, transformer moves, and other jobs where front axle capacity, frame strength, and cooling reserve are non-negotiable. Buyers should also pay attention to PTO provisions, wet kit setup, sliding fifth wheel versus fixed plate, and the ability to match kingpin settings with the trailers they plan to pull.
Cab condition and service history still matter, but heavy haul buyers should inspect beyond normal fleet items. Look closely at frame modifications, evidence of overload stress, suspension bushing wear, brake spec, and tire condition across all positions. Cooling system service, clutch life if equipped, DPF and aftertreatment history, and signs of driveline vibration are especially important on used heavy haul trucks. A properly spec'd Kenworth can serve in both specialized over-dimensional freight and demanding everyday tractor work, but the best value comes from matching axle ratings, gearing, frame spec, and trailer requirements to the actual loads being moved.
Frequently Asked Questions
What makes a Kenworth truck a heavy haul truck instead of a standard highway tractor?
A Kenworth heavy haul truck is typically defined by its chassis and drivetrain specification rather than just the badge on the hood. Key differences include higher axle ratings, stronger frame rails, heavier suspensions, deeper rear axle ratios, larger cooling systems, and driveline components selected for high gross combination weights. Many heavy haul trucks also include double-frame construction, locking differentials, PTO capability, and front axle capacities that support specialized trailers and permit loads.
Which Kenworth models are commonly used for heavy haul work?
Kenworth W900, T800, and C500 models are the most recognized heavy haul platforms because they are commonly spec'd for severe-duty applications and high front axle capacities. Some T680 tractors also appear in lighter heavy haul or specialized regional service when they are configured with the right drivetrain, frame, and axle ratings. The model matters, but the actual build sheet matters more because two trucks with the same model name can have very different capacities and operating ranges.
What specs should I check first on a used Kenworth heavy haul truck?
Start with front axle rating, rear axle rating, wheelbase, frame specification, transmission model, and rear axle ratio. Then confirm suspension rating, fifth wheel setup, PTO or wet kit provisions, and cooling package. These details determine how the truck will handle trailer pin weight, startup load, grade performance, and legal weight distribution. Service records for brakes, clutch, driveline, and aftertreatment are also important because heavy haul service puts more stress on these systems than standard linehaul work.
Is an automatic transmission suitable for heavy haul service?
An automatic or automated manual can work well in heavy haul service if it is paired with the correct engine torque rating, gearing, and transmission calibration. The important factor is not simply whether the truck shifts automatically, but whether the transmission is designed for high GCW operation and low-speed maneuvering under load. For specialized hauling, buyers should verify gear ratio spread, low-speed control, and manufacturer rating for the intended application.
How important are rear axle ratio and suspension rating in heavy haul applications?
They are critical because they directly affect pulling power, startability, driveline stress, and stability under load. A truck with highway gearing may run efficiently at speed but struggle with heavy lowboy work or repeated starts on grades. Suspension rating is equally important because it determines how much weight the chassis can support and how well it manages load transfer. In heavy haul, the wrong ratio or suspension can limit the truck long before horsepower becomes the issue.
